Heat-map of the global dynamic sensitivity analysis of adrenal steroid concentrations produced by NCI-H295R cells. The global dynamic sensitivity analysis is a powerful tool to comprehensively understand the dependencies of the model parameters in the mathematical model of the biological complex system. Dynamic sensitivities of model parameters in the mathematical model of adrenal steroidogenesis in NCI-H295R cells were calculated for all steroid concentrations in the culture medium every 6 h until 72 h after stimulation. To clarify the view of heat-map of global dynamic sensitivity analysis, imaginary data of the dynamics of steroid concentrations in the original model (blue line) and perturbed model for sensitivity analysis (red line) were prepared (a). Using this imaginary data, the calculated dynamic sensitivities (b) and the visualized dynamic sensitivity as one block of the heat-map (c) were shown, respectively. By the same method that explained using imaginary data, the large-scale data of the global dynamic sensitivity analysis on the mathematical model of adrenal steroidogenesis in NCI-H295R cells was comprehensively visualized as a big graph of heat-map (d).
